Icon Plc (NASDAQ:ICLR – Get Free Report) hit a new 52-week low during trading on Thursday . The stock traded as low as $90.00 and last traded at $75.0010, with a volume of 471306 shares trading hands. The stock had previously closed at $133.14.
Key Headlines Impacting Icon
Here are the key news stories impacting Icon this week:
- Positive Sentiment: Leerink Partners reaffirmed a “market perform” rating and a $105 price target (roughly 31% above current levels), indicating at least one analyst still sees recovery potential if the situation stabilizes. Leerink PT Report
- Neutral Sentiment: ICON issued a formal update saying it has delayed release of Q4 and full‑year 2025 results while its Audit Committee investigates accounting practices — a material corporate disclosure but the company has not yet reported findings or restatements. Business Wire: Company Update
- Neutral Sentiment: Analyst consensus (per Zacks) expected a decline in earnings ahead of the report — this weak baseline reduces the likelihood of an easy earnings surprise even before the accounting probe. Zacks Earnings Preview
- Negative Sentiment: Market reaction: multiple outlets report a sharp share-price collapse after the probe and earnings delay were disclosed — headlines cite a 30%+ intraday plunge and record one‑day losses, driven by uncertainty over the company’s financials and guidance. Investing.com: Stock Plummets
- Negative Sentiment: ICON pulled its 2025 outlook amid the ongoing probe, amplifying investor concern that prior guidance or reported results may need revision. Seeking Alpha: Outlook Pulled
- Negative Sentiment: Several plaintiff and securities‑fraud law firms (Rosen Law, Johnson Fistel, Block & Leviton) have launched or publicized investigations into potential claims — a common follow‑on after accounting probes that can lead to litigation risk, settlements and added costs. Rosen Law Firm Notice
- Negative Sentiment: Bank of America reaffirmed an “underperform” rating with a $75 target, reinforcing downside risk from some corners of the sell‑side. Finviz / BofA Note
Wall Street Analysts Forecast Growth
Several equities research analysts have recently commented on the company. Mizuho set a $216.00 price objective on Icon in a report on Friday, January 9th. TD Cowen raised their target price on shares of Icon from $172.00 to $183.00 and gave the company a “hold” rating in a research note on Thursday, January 22nd. Barclays lifted their target price on Icon from $185.00 to $200.00 and gave the stock an “equal weight” rating in a research note on Monday, December 15th. Weiss Ratings restated a “hold (c)” rating on shares of Icon in a research note on Monday, December 29th. Finally, Robert W. Baird set a $217.00 price target on Icon in a report on Friday, January 9th. Five research analysts have rated the stock with a Buy rating, eleven have given a Hold rating and one has assigned a Sell rating to the stock. Based on data from MarketBeat, Icon currently has an average rating of “Hold” and a consensus price target of $179.93.
Icon Price Performance
The firm has a market capitalization of $6.70 billion, a price-to-earnings ratio of 11.23, a P/E/G ratio of 3.03 and a beta of 1.27. The company’s 50 day moving average is $179.90 and its 200 day moving average is $176.28. The company has a quick ratio of 1.06, a current ratio of 1.06 and a debt-to-equity ratio of 0.31.
Hedge Funds Weigh In On Icon
Hedge funds have recently added to or reduced their stakes in the stock. Mitchell Capital Management Co. acquired a new position in Icon in the third quarter valued at $1,627,000. Tributary Capital Management LLC increased its stake in shares of Icon by 84.5% in the 3rd quarter. Tributary Capital Management LLC now owns 11,752 shares of the medical research company’s stock valued at $2,057,000 after acquiring an additional 5,381 shares in the last quarter. Stephens Investment Management Group LLC boosted its stake in Icon by 15.7% during the third quarter. Stephens Investment Management Group LLC now owns 480,104 shares of the medical research company’s stock worth $84,018,000 after acquiring an additional 65,264 shares in the last quarter. Rothschild Investment LLC acquired a new position in Icon during the 3rd quarter worth approximately $1,730,000. Finally, Principal Financial Group Inc. boosted its holdings in Icon by 739.2% in the third quarter. Principal Financial Group Inc. now owns 3,277,293 shares of the medical research company’s stock worth $573,526,000 after acquiring an additional 2,886,755 shares in the last quarter. Institutional investors own 95.61% of the company’s stock.
About Icon
Icon plc (NASDAQ: ICLR) is a global provider of outsourced drug development and clinical research services to the pharmaceutical, biotechnology and medical device industries. The company partners with clients at all stages of the product life cycle, offering expertise in protocol design, trial execution and regulatory compliance across a broad range of therapeutic areas.
Icon’s service portfolio encompasses clinical trial management, data management and biostatistics, medical imaging, pharmacovigilance and safety monitoring, laboratory sciences and specialized analytical solutions.
See Also
- Five stocks we like better than Icon
- USAU: The U.S. Gold-Copper Story Investors Can’t Ignore.
- The DoD just got a new drone supplier
- Think You Missed Silver? You’re Wrong. Here’s Why.
- When to buy gold (mathematically)
- ISPC: From Small Cap to Life Sciences Market Disruptor!
Receive News & Ratings for Icon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Icon and related companies with MarketBeat.com's FREE daily email newsletter.
